The Consulting Services (“the Services”) shall include undertaking the people-centered road safety audits (PCRSAs) both at Preliminary design stage (RSA Stage 2) and Detailed Design stage (RSA Stage 3) of selected regional roads in Lindi, Geita and Tanga regions in line with the requirements of National Laws and the World Bank Environmental and Social Framework (ESF) as well as People Centered Design principles, deploying about 32 professional staff months.
  4. The detailed Terms of Reference (ToR) for the assignment can be found at the following website: http://www.tanroads.ao.tz.
  5. Within this context, the Consultant shall be entrusted with the following responsibilities as described in the Terms of References (TOR) for the Assignment:
  • undertake a field inspection to see how the road design proposal interacts with its surroundings and nearby roads, to visualize potential impediments and conflicts for road- users. The field inspection shall essentially be organized during the daylight. However, it would be ideal to also conduct field inspection at night time. The audit team, while conducting field inspection, shall briefly engage with key road-users, schools, medical facilities, shops, etc. to better understand the access pattern of various road-users and any underlying road safety concerns. Photographs shall be taken to include them in the PCRSA report, for better explanation of road safety findings,
  • prepare the PCRSA report. The TANROADS staff seconded to support the PCRSA / accompanied the PCRSA, shall be involved in the report preparation process for capacity building reasons. The report shall clearly explain the audit’s road safety findings, and recommendations on how the identified road safety deficiencies may be addressed. Photographs shall be used to visibly explain the findings and recommendations. The location (chainage) shall be precisely mentioned against each safety finding, and
  • organize a completion meeting, where the Consultant shall present the PCRSA findings and recommendations to the client (road agency), design consultants and ESIA consultants
